One In, One Out

July 01, 20262 min read

My mom taught me the secret to an uncluttered closet.

She said, whenever you buy something new, you have to get rid of something else.

It's about replacement, not collection.

The same is true in your business and work.

So often, I see coaches collecting programs and courses. Then they get overwhelmed trying to figure out how to do them all.

Then, when they get overwhelmed, they stop working on what they have, and they go shopping for something new.

Remember, a confused mind always procrastinates.

Instead of getting stuck in this cycle, take a look at the programs you've been collecting.

Truthfully, many of them are outdated, especially those that are focused on social media, lead generation, and content. What worked two years ago doesn't work now.

Be brave, and toss them.

If you can't bear to delete them, at least shove them into an archive folder so they aren't distracting you. It's the business equivalent of putting them in a box in the attic. Not ideal, but better than keeping it front and center.

Then pick ONE recent program or course and implement it in full. Yes, do all the things. Every single one of them, even the hard ones.
